A year ago, Allie Grotteland, RN, was frustrated with her life. Overwhelmed by $36,000 of student loan and credit card debt and no savings, she felt hopeless. Fast forward to today –- and she has managed to pay off that $36,000 of debt and save $10,000 for her wedding. She's now helping others get themselves out of debt with her new course, The 3 Phases to Financial Freedom.

After moving across country with no savings to take her dream job, Allie was awakened to the real world of life after college. With $36,000 in student loan debt she found herself constantly working overtime to just barely make ends meet. Frustrated and overwhelmed, Allie decided there had to be a better way to get out of debt without sacrificing everything. She went on a search for that way, and after some trial and error, she found it. Within 12 months, Allie Grotteland, paid off the $36,000 in debt and save $10,000 for her wedding.
